如何在表达式引擎上使用 Exp:resso 的商店时更改产品窗体以显示修饰符库存?



为我的商店创建产品页面时,很容易显示{total_stock}。但是,如何显示修饰符的库存,或根据其库存禁用修饰符?

例如,在卖衣服时,我只想启用库存的尺寸。

问题是库存链接到SKU,SKU并不总是直接映射到修饰符。例如,如果"衬衫"产品具有尺寸和颜色,那么您不能明确地说"大"是否没有库存,因为它也取决于颜色。

也就是说,如果您的产品只有一个修饰符,则有1-1映射。您应该能够使用{modifier_options}循环中的{option_stock_level}访问库存级别,例如:

{modifiers}
    <select name="{modifier_input_name}">
        {modifier_options}
            <option value="{option_id}">
                {option_name} ({option_stock_level} remaining)
            </option>
        {/modifier_options}
    </select>
{/modifiers}

相关内容

  • 没有找到相关文章

最新更新